    Description

      When using the QAdwaitaDecorations plugin on Gnome, which adds a drop shadow around the window, an area equal to the width of the shadow is unclickable on the bottom and right sides of the windows. It seems that the calculation to determine whether the cursor is over the window content incorrectly subtracts the shadow width from the size of the content.
